FIFA president Gianni Infantino’s glowing praise for Argentina’s World Cup final performance — despite zero shots on target, a red card, and a post-match brawl — has sparked outrage and accusations of favoritism. In a letter to Argentine FA president Claudio Tapia, Infantino hailed the team’s “magnificent performance” and “professionalism,” calling the tournament an “unforgettable celebration.” But with Argentina’s controversial conduct — including an on-field fight and a mocking banner toward England — fans and critics are questioning whether Infantino’s praise is too quick, too biased, or simply out of touch.
